Who installs YOUR glass

I am looking for good installers for stained glass in Los Angeles, where code requires door and window installations be done by a licensed contractor. Could you share how you have found contractors to install your glass work?

Well, LA is a pretty big area. You might check with your local Builders Association. they might be able to refer you to someone. Try the Yellow Pages under "Contractors" or maybe "Carpeters". Double check references and make sure they show you a copy of thier insurance bond. Last option...get you contractors licence and do it yourself...if you can afford it. I hear it's pretty pricey in CA to get it.

I'd call the Greek Orthodox or Roman Catholic church at their diocesan offices and ask them who installed the glass in their new cathederals. Another possibility is The Getty. You might also want to check the conservation department at The Getty if their building projects or facility manager isn't quick with the information.
